Crosswagon front suspension
Hi all,
i have shock absorber failure on my '05 Crosswagon and alfa says they are not available anymore! Or at least delivery time is awfully long....
Does anyone of you know if shocks from "standard height" 156 will fit?? they are with a different number but if dimensions are the same and i would buy a set with adjustable stiffness i think it would work fine.
thanks in advance.

Later Crosswagons used the Sportwagon Q4 front dampers, p/n 50705574.
Can you get those any quicker?

No proper solution found yet, i bought a set of Q4 dampers. They do fit but front end is a LOT lower than it used to be
about 30mm lower...

On the EPER SW Q4 has shock absorber prod. code 50705574, but CW Q4 50704478. And SW should be lower.

ok, there is a note in later ePER though next to the Q4 part:
"10932 - EXTENDED USE OF SHOCK ABSORBERS STREET VERSION ON CROSSWAGON VERSION (DAT 15/02/2006) "
If the spring seat height is the same on both, then the ride height should stay the same.

Seat height on crosswagon compared to SW Q4 seems to go something like this:
http://www.alfabbs.fi/download/file.php?id=4417
Q4 SW
X: 22cm
Y: 47,5cm
crosswagon
X: 25cm
Y: 52cm
Measured with basic measuring tape so measurements are not very accurate...
